 MOTD
Section: Linux Programmer's Manual (5) Updated: 1992-12-29Index
Return to Main Contents 
 NAME
motd - message of the day
 DESCRIPTION
The contents of
/etc/motd 
are displayed by
login (1)
after a successful login but just before it executes the login shell.
 
The abbreviation "motd" stands for "message of the day", and this file
has been traditionally used for exactly that (it requires much less disk
space than mail to all users).
